X665 YBF is a 2000 Mazda MX-5 in Red with a 1,598c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 76.2%.
Across all 2000 Mazda MX-5 models, the average MOT pass rate is 72.2% with a typical mileage of 76,778 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Mazda MX-5 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 44,475 recorded failures. If you're considering buying X665 YBF, it's worth having these areas checked by a mechanic before committing.
The Mazda MX-5 typically stays on UK roads for around 36 years. At 26 years old, this Mazda MX-5 is well into its expected lifespan but still has years ahead.
